Time Out for Touring Inc. is a Calgary based sightseeing tour company, operating in Alberta year round since 1999. "Destination Anywhere" in Alberta, Time Out for Touring can take guests to Calgary, Edmonton, Banff, Lake Louise, Jasper, Columbia Icefields, Drumheller, Kananaskis, Waterton, and many other exciting locations to all the must-see destinations. Time Out also offers trip planning, be it for a day or a multi-day vacation. Transportation is available in an air-conditioned seven passenger van, 14 passenger van or up to a 55 passenger motorcoach. Airport transfers, private charters, corporate, incentives, meet and greet service, events, pre and post tours, companions programs, seniors, special interests, and custom designed unique, personalized programs and more are available. Kootenay Wilderness Tours Using aspects of Native culture, guests explore the bond between nature and the human spirit. Activities include hiking, backpacking, river rafting, mountain biking and horseback riding. Multi-day tours include meals, accommodation and a knowledgeable guide. Packages from 3 to 8 days.

True North Tours Ltd. / Rocky Express Explore the Rocky Mountains on a budget with one of the 3 to 10-day eco-adventure tours offered by True North Tours. Choose from Banff, Jasper or Waterton Lakes National Parks with Banff or Calgary departures. Hostel accommodation, most meals and guided scenic hikes are included, plus optional daily adventure activities for those craving more excitement.
